    Homo- and hetero-, bi- and tri-nuclear palladium(II) and platinum(II) complexes containing single bridging chalcogenolate of a metallo-ligand, [MCl(ECH2CH2NMe2)(PR3)] (M=Pt, Pd; E=Se, Te)
    摘要:
    Bi- and tri-nuclear palladium/platinum complexes of the types [MCl(ECH2CH2NMe2)(PR3)M'Cl-2(PR3)] (M, M'= Pd or Pt) and [{PtCl(SeCH2CH2NMe2)(PR3)}(2)M' Cl-2] (M' = Pd or Pt; PR3 = PEt3 or PPr3n) have been prepared. All complexes were characterized 3 by elemental analysis, NMR (H-1, (31)p, Se-77, Te-125, Pt-195) data. The structures of [PdCl(SeCH2CH2NMe2)(PPh3)PtCl2(PPh3)] and [{PtCl(SeCH2CH2NMe2)(PEt3)}(2)PtCl2] have been established by single crystal X-ray diffraction analysis. In the latter complex, three square planar platinum atoms are held together by the single bridging selenolate group in an almost linear chain arrangement. (c) 2007 Elsevier B.V. All rights reserved.
